The expected share of profits of Cathay Pacific shareholders will reach HK$13.5 billion in 2026 and HK$14.8 billion in 2027; it is estimated that the return on equity (ROE) for shareholders will increase to 23.9% in 2027, reaching a new high since 2010.
Lyon released a research report stating that the target market rate of Cathay Pacific Airways (00293) has been raised from 1.41 times to 1.61 times, and the target price has been raised from HK$13.5 to HK$16.4. The rating has been upgraded from "hold" to "outperform". Cathay Pacific's recent profit forecast for the first half of 2026 has made the bank more optimistic about its freight business performance, while its passenger business demand remains stable with resilient profitability. Taking into account updated profitability assumptions and factors such as the proposed disposal income of Air China (00753) in the first half of 2026, the bank has raised its net profit forecasts for Cathay Pacific in 2026 and 2027 by 54% and 37% respectively. The bank expects that Cathay Pacific's shareholders' profit will reach HK$13.5 billion in 2026 and HK$14.8 billion in 2027. It is expected that the return on equity (ROE) in 2027 will increase to 23.9%, reaching a new high since 2010.
